方法的重载
方法重载的规则:
1.必须在同一个类中
2.方法名必须一致
3.形参必须不同 (1.形参类型不同 2.形参个数不同,两种任意有一个不同,都可以),
4.修饰符和返回值跟方法重载无关,因为你调用方法的时候不会调用方法类型,只会用到方法名和参数。
作用:可以使相同的方法名实现不同功能。
方法重载的概念其实最常见的地方就是构造器,常常是一个类中有多个构造方法,它们有相同的名字,
但是往往参数不同,这样就可以使用不同情况下的初始化任务。
实例:
class Person{
方法重载的规则:
1.必须在同一个类中
2.方法名必须一致
3.形参必须不同 (1.形参类型不同 2.形参个数不同,两种任意有一个不同,都可以),
4.修饰符和返回值跟方法重载无关,因为你调用方法的时候不会调用方法类型,只会用到方法名和参数。
作用:可以使相同的方法名实现不同功能。
方法重载的概念其实最常见的地方就是构造器,常常是一个类中有多个构造方法,它们有相同的名字,
但是往往参数不同,这样就可以使用不同情况下的初始化任务。
实例:
class Person{
public Person(){
}
public Person(int a){
}
public Person(int a,int b){
}
public Person(int a,String b ){
}
}